The Norwegian government has announced plans to order ten NASAMS launch units and four fire control centres from Kongsberg Defence & Aerospace for donation to Ukraine.

This order, which is subject to approval by the Norwegian Parliament, is in addition to repurchasing the equipment already donated to Ukraine.

The Norwegian Defence Minister, Søren Arild Gram, emphasized the importance of air defence in Ukraine, particularly in light of Russian missile and drone attacks.
